public class FavoriteManager
extends java.lang.Object
| Modifier and Type | Method and Description | 
|---|---|
| int | add(FavoritePoiInfo poiInfo)添加一个poi点 | 
| boolean | clearAllFavPois()清空所有收藏点 | 
| boolean | deleteFavPoi(java.lang.String id)删除一个收藏点 | 
| void | destroy()释放功能实例 | 
| java.util.List<FavoritePoiInfo> | getAllFavPois()获取所有收藏点信息 | 
| FavoritePoiInfo | getFavPoi(java.lang.String id)获取一个收藏点信息 | 
| static FavoriteManager | getInstance()获取点收藏实例 | 
| void | init()初始化 | 
| boolean | updateFavPoi(java.lang.String id,
            FavoritePoiInfo info)更新一个收藏点 | 
public static FavoriteManager getInstance()
public void init()
public int add(FavoritePoiInfo poiInfo)
poiInfo - 点信息,in/out,输出包含id和添加时间public FavoritePoiInfo getFavPoi(java.lang.String id)
id - 添加时返回的id,也可通过getAllFavPois获取的信息中FavoritePoiInfo的属性idpublic java.util.List<FavoritePoiInfo> getAllFavPois()
public boolean deleteFavPoi(java.lang.String id)
id - 添加时返回的id,也可通过getAllFavPois获取的信息中FavoritePoiInfo的属性idpublic boolean clearAllFavPois()
public boolean updateFavPoi(java.lang.String id,
                            FavoritePoiInfo info)
id - 添加时返回的id,也可通过getAllFavPois获取的信息中FavoritePoiInfo的属性idinfo - 更新信息public void destroy()